Frequently Asked Questions

My North Salem roof looks worn - should I be concerned about its age?

Roofs in Salem Center built around 1971 are now 55 years old, exceeding the typical 30-year lifespan of architectural asphalt shingles. On 1/2 inch CDX plywood decking, these materials degrade through decades of UV exposure and moisture cycles from thunderstorms and nor'easters. The shingles lose granules, become brittle, and the underlying decking can develop soft spots where fasteners no longer hold securely. This aging process creates vulnerability to wind uplift and water intrusion during peak storm seasons.

What makes a roof truly storm-resistant for our North Salem weather?

North Salem's 115 mph wind zone requires shingles rated for Vult wind speeds with enhanced fastening patterns. Class 4 impact-rated shingles are financially necessary because they withstand 1.0-inch hail common in June-August thunderstorms without requiring immediate replacement. This resilience prevents small storm damage from becoming major leaks during October-November nor'easters, protecting both your home and insurance deductible.

How can you tell if my roof has hidden moisture damage?

Infrared thermal imaging inspections detect sub-surface moisture in architectural asphalt shingles that traditional visual assessments miss. This technology identifies temperature variations indicating wet insulation or compromised decking beneath apparently intact shingles. In Salem Center's climate, catching these issues early prevents rot progression in the plywood decking and avoids more extensive structural repairs later.

Could my attic mold problem be related to roof ventilation?

Improper ventilation on steep 8/12 pitch roofs traps moist air, leading to attic condensation and mold growth. The 2020 Residential Code of New York State requires specific intake and exhaust ratios to maintain proper airflow. Balanced ventilation prevents ice dams in winter and reduces attic temperatures in summer, protecting both roof structure and interior air quality throughout North Salem's seasonal extremes.

Should I consider solar shingles instead of traditional roofing?

Traditional architectural asphalt shingles offer proven performance at lower initial cost, while integrated solar shingles provide energy generation under the NY-Sun Incentive Program and 30% Federal ITC. For 2026 energy costs, the decision balances upfront investment against long-term savings, with solar requiring specific roof orientation and structural assessment. Both options must meet the same wind and impact ratings for North Salem's climate resilience.
